Qualifications
  • Graduated from an accredited Associate degree program or Medical Assistant program or have at least 2 years of relevant experience. Required
  • Laboratory and phlebotomy training required within 30 days of hire. Required
  • Drug and alcohol screening, and N95 training required within 30 days of hire. Required
  • Must provide copy of HS diploma or equivalent, or highest level of completed degree obtained. Required

 

Work Experience
  • At least one year of professional experience in a clinic setting. Preferred
  • Computer experience. Required

 

Licenses & Certifications
  • RMA, AAMA, CCMA or NCCT certification is required upon hire. Required
  • Bi-Annual CPR certification. Required
  • Active RMA, AAMA, CCMA or NCCT certification must be maintained. Required
  • Audiometry certification through Northern Illinois University or Health Conservation, Inc. (HCI), required within 30 days of hire. Required
